Sourcing guidance for Marine Cummins Engine

What are the key technical specifications to consider when selecting a Marine Cummins Engine?

When sourcing a Marine Cummins Engine, you must prioritize Engine Displacement and Horsepower (HP) to ensure it matches your vessel's displacement and intended use (e.g., trawling vs. high-speed patrol). Key technical factors include the Cooling System type (Heat Exchanger vs. Keel Cooling), Aspiration (Turbocharged or Aftercooled), and the Governor type (Mechanical for simplicity or Electronic for fuel efficiency). Ensure the engine features Marine-grade components such as corrosion-resistant water pumps and shielded electrical systems to withstand harsh saltwater environments.

Which international maritime compliance standards must the engine meet?

Compliance is non-negotiable in international waters. You must verify that the engine meets IMO Tier II or Tier III emission standards depending on the vessel's build date and operating area. For specific markets, look for EPA Tier 3/4 (USA) or EU Stage V compliance. Additionally, ensure the manufacturer provides certifications from major classification societies such as ABS (American Bureau of Shipping), DNV, or LR (Lloyd's Register) to guarantee structural safety and insurance eligibility.

How do I evaluate the economic feasibility and long-term value of the purchase?

Focus on the Total Cost of Ownership (TCO) rather than just the initial purchase price. Evaluate the Specific Fuel Consumption (SFC) rates, as fuel accounts for the majority of operational costs. Inquire about the Time Between Overhauls (TBO); a high-quality Cummins engine should offer a long service life before requiring a major rebuild. Also, confirm the Global Warranty Coverage, ensuring that the warranty is valid in your specific region and covers both parts and specialized labor.

What are the typical usage scenarios for different Cummins Marine series?

The B and C series (e.g., 6BT, 6CT) are ideal for light-duty commercial fishing and recreational boats due to their compact size and reliability. The L and M series are suited for medium-duty workboats and ferries requiring higher torque. For heavy-duty applications like tugboats or large cargo vessels, the K series (e.g., KTA19, KTA38, KTA50) is the industry standard, known for its extreme durability and continuous duty cycles.

Cross-Border Procurement Risks and Strategies for Marine Engines

How can I verify the authenticity of a 'Genuine Cummins' engine from a cross-border supplier?

Counterfeit or 'refurbished-as-new' engines are a significant risk. Always request the Engine Serial Number (ESN) before shipping and verify it through the Cummins QuickServe online portal. Ensure the Nameplate is original and not tampered with. What are the best practices for negotiating payment and ensuring transaction security?

Given the high unit value of marine engines, use Secured Payment terms or Letters of Credit (L/C) to mitigate risk. Avoid paying 100% upfront; a standard 30% deposit and 70% balance against the Bill of Lading (B/L) after a successful Pre-shipment Inspection (PSI) is recommended. Utilize third-party inspection services like SGS or Intertek to conduct a 'Cold Start' and 'Load Bank' test at the factory before final payment.

What logistics and shipping precautions should be taken for heavy machinery?

Marine engines are heavy and sensitive to moisture. Specify Seaworthy Packaging, including vacuum-sealed plastic wrapping, VCI (Volatile Corrosion Inhibitor) paper, and solid wooden crates (IPPC certified). For shipping to international ports, use FOB (Free On Board) terms if you have a reliable freight forwarder, or CIF (Cost, Insurance, and Freight) to ensure the supplier handles insurance against transit damage.

How do I handle customs clearance and import duties for marine engines?

Check the HS Code (typically 840810) for marine propulsion engines in your country to calculate duties and taxes. Ensure the supplier provides a Certificate of Origin (CO), which may qualify you for reduced tariffs under Free Trade Agreements. Be aware of local environmental regulations; some countries prohibit the import of engines that do not meet the latest emission tier requirements.
